Benefits of Outsourcing Software Development – Band of Coders

What You Need to Know About Outsourcing Software

You only require to pay one-off project costs and also various other expenditures on the called for job. No lasting dedication: Software outsourcing is a project-based model. This suggests that services are not connected to dealing with only one supplier over the long-term. It also assists in saving cash as there is no requirement to set up for retainers if you are taking care of a low-maintenance task.

Other articles about

Outsourcing Software Development Services: 2021 Guide

Therefore, augmented programmers serve as an extension of a company’s internal team of permanent programmers. Increased developers do anything that the in-house team is anticipated to do. This includes reporting to their supervisors daily as well as going to day-to-day conferences. The IT team enhancement approach appropriates for almost all projects, despite whether the task is complicated or https://reformourleaders.Net/community/profile/elisarosetta323/ simple.

Maintains regulate as well as oversight: https://Thehealthstudents.Com This version makes it much easier for a customer to collect feedback and supervise the project’s development. Besides, increased developers swiftly integrate right into the in-house group. This makes it less complicated to maintain track of the job process as well as offer records. Makes use of Devoted groups: Outsourcing suppliers use skilled engineers per customer, which means that the team focuses on just one job at an offered time.

Thus, the customer can decide that to assign a given job and a details project. Makes Use Of Delivery Team Design An outsourcing supplier sets up a software advancement group to use premium IT know-how that adds a lot more worth in this setting. The distribution group technique is extra ideal for projects that need full management from the vendor.

Outsourcing Software Development: Pros and Cons

The model leaves the obligation of giving IT assumptions to the client for the required roles. This assists develop a committed development team. A few of the settings include software program programmers, and job managers. It additionally includes quality control experts, as well as various other roles required in completing a project. In addition to developing a team, the vendor also takes every job administration, people administration, and also procedure quality.

Streamlined group as well as project monitoring: delivery teams help lower the client’s problem as well as boost capability by taking responsibility for the project. The majority of firms participate in outsourcing to resolve issues with capability. Access to leading tech ability: the version makes it possible for firms to access a large swimming pool of talent. Includes value right away: the model enables the supplier to put together delivery teams and also manage them to make certain the job is performed to a high criterion.

Keep control: despite the fact that the contracting out companion is in charge of running the project, the customer maintains the general control. This indicates that just the customer can make significant decisions. The advantages as well as downsides of Software application Outsourcing Upsides (Pros) of Outsourcing Software Program Growth 1. Concentrate on Core competencies It is virtually impossible for one company to handle all the elements of the item supply chain effectively.

Allow’s take into consideration a massive commercial firm that specializes in the manufacturing of alcoholic drinks. The core competencies consist of guaranteeing high quality, regulating the production, supporting the personnel, and also continually enhancing the formula. With all these features on their table, is it fine to add delivery as well as transportation of the products, or would it be better to hire a firm to manage that task? The exact same situation puts on outsourcing software program.

Software Outsourcing: Lets start your outsourcing project

This helps increase efficiency and also make sure business has the ability to preserve an affordable side. 2. Control over foreseeable payment and Https://Mybees.Co.Uk/Community/Profile/Micheline45195 also costs Most firms contract out specific features for cost-effectiveness. Contracting out software application development enables an organization to take advantage of decreasing functional costs and capital. Therefore, there is no requirement to work with an in-house group of programmers as you will certainly wind up spending extra on their assistance.

Effective Strategies: Outsourcing Software Development - Full ScaleSoftware Development Outsourcing – A Free Guide from DICEUS

Outsourcing allows you to access a group with all the needed resources and abilities. There is no requirement to obtain expensive essential software, hardware tools, as well as services. The outsourcing company that you choose to work with will deal with all these needs. In addition, outsourcing enables you to budget plan well for your expenses.

3. Continue to be adaptability Making mistakes in creating the current modern technology can be rather expensive for any business, particularly startups and SMEs. The ideal outsourcing service vendor will use a guide on making the ideal tech decisions that satisfy your organization needs. The solution provider and the group have the capacity as well as capability to implement a task effectively.

Additionally, once your job is completed and introduced, you quit paying any fees. This implies that there will certainly be no further fees unless you wish to continue with item development as well as support. 4. Access to relevant experience as well as set of skills Working with a provider to apply your task allows you to access a team of proficient and also seasoned IT professionals.

Software Development Outsourcing: When and How to Do It

The majority of outsourcing companies like the level of competency of the programmers that they employ. Each participant of the group is well-trained as well as certified in all the technologies that the firm supplies. Thus, working with the ideal outsourcing companion makes certain that you have a trustworthy provider to assist you via the advancement process.

5. Maintain reliability and also quality Normally, service carriers have full responsibility for the team’s performance and also top quality that the team creates. Vendors prepare an agreement that manages repayments, charges for the two events, as well as due dates. They likewise prepare an agreement on intellectual property rights along with various other facets of the collaboration.

How To Successfully Outsource Software Development - IT & Software  Engineering Company - Vizah GmbHTop Countries for Software Development Outsourcing

These consist of locating a committed team of professionals with technology expertise, low rates, and also impressive top quality. However, the practice has some imperfections that you additionally need to know. 1. Various service society All companies have developed a functioning society that fits their operations and also demands. Yet, the society may really feel uncommon for brand-new staff members or remote IT professionals.

Dealing with a brand-new strategy in administration might create you to feel like you have actually blown up over the project. Such imperfections can be avoided by picking the most favored business procedure structure at the very early stages. Doing this makes sure that the partnership between you, the outsourcing vendor, as well as your company satisfies your assumptions.

Print Friendly, PDF & Email